2. Challenges Of Reusing Solar Panels
It is commonly accepted that recycling photovoltaic panels has many ecological advantages, nonetheless, it is additionally true that the process isn't without its difficulties. However just what are these difficulties? Let's investigate additionally.
One of the biggest concerns with recycling solar panels is the complexity of the job itself. It can be challenging to break down the different parts, such as glass and metal, to be reused independently. Furthermore, photovoltaic panel makers often have a mix of materials utilized in their items that makes sorting them even more difficult. Moreover, there are safety and security and health and wellness threats involved with taking care of broken glass or breathing in fumes from melting components.
An additional crucial obstacle connected with reusing solar panels is price. Many nations do not have adequate framework or sources to sufficiently recycle these things which leads to greater expenditures for companies attempting to do so. Additionally, as a result of the specific nature of recycling photovoltaic panels, this can produce a financial concern on companies trying to remain certified with guidelines. Inevitably, these expenses could be given to customers making it challenging for them to pay for renewable resource resources.
